Looking for orbiton dispersion features in GdVO3 with the aim of RIXS

Description

We compute the theoretical RIXS spectra for the dd excitations at the vanadium L3 edge in GdVO3, as a function of energy and momentum transfer, by factorizing the RIXS spectral function into two parts: (i) a single-site part with a core hole present and (ii) a lattice part without the core hole. The obtained results are compared with the direct measurements on the compound for four different angles, carried out with SAXES at the ADDRESS beamline (PSI Villigen, Switzerland). The experimental spectra show a shoulder at low energy with a clearly visible shift corresponding to different momentum transfers. We investigate the possible origin of this shift, in order to distinguish between a crystal field effect (weight transfer between two or more different peaks) and an orbiton dispersion feature predicted by the superexchange mechanism for 3d2 degenerate electrons in V3+ ions.
